The global green roof systems market, valued at $782 million in 2025, is experiencing robust growth, projected to expand at a Compound Annual Growth Rate (CAGR) of 9.9% from 2025 to 2033. This expansion is fueled by several key drivers. Increasing urbanization and the consequent need for sustainable urban development are creating significant demand. Government regulations promoting green infrastructure and energy efficiency are incentivizing the adoption of green roofs, particularly in commercial and industrial sectors. Furthermore, the growing awareness of the environmental benefits of green roofs, including reduced stormwater runoff, improved air quality, and enhanced biodiversity, is driving market adoption. The layered green roof system segment currently holds a larger market share compared to modular systems due to its cost-effectiveness and suitability for large-scale projects. However, modular systems are gaining traction owing to their ease of installation and adaptability to various building types and sizes. The commercial sector dominates the application segment, followed by industrial and residential sectors. The residential segment's growth is expected to accelerate, driven by increasing awareness among homeowners about the benefits of green roofs and the availability of more user-friendly and affordable solutions. Geographic growth varies, with North America and Europe currently leading, although Asia-Pacific is poised for significant growth, particularly in rapidly developing economies like China and India. Challenges include high initial installation costs and the need for specialized maintenance, which could potentially constrain growth in certain segments.
The competitive landscape is fragmented, with several established players and emerging companies vying for market share. Key players are focusing on product innovation, strategic partnerships, and geographical expansion to strengthen their market position. Several key factors are fueling the remarkable growth of the green roof systems market. Firstly, escalating concerns regarding climate change and the urgent need for sustainable urban development are significantly impacting building design and construction practices. Green roofs mitigate the urban heat island effect, reduce stormwater runoff, and improve air quality, aligning perfectly with global sustainability goals. Secondly, government regulations and incentives in many regions are actively promoting the adoption of green infrastructure solutions, including green roofs. Tax credits, building codes requiring green spaces, and subsidies are making green roof installation more economically viable. Thirdly, the rising awareness among building owners and occupants about the numerous environmental and economic benefits associated with green roofs is further accelerating market growth. Reduced energy consumption, improved building insulation, extended roof lifespan, and enhanced property values are significant attractors. Lastly, advancements in technology have led to the development of innovative green roof systems that are lighter, more durable, and easier to install than their predecessors, making them more accessible and cost-effective for a wider range of applications.
Despite the significant growth potential, several challenges impede the widespread adoption of green roof systems. High initial installation costs remain a significant barrier, particularly for residential applications. The need for specialized design, engineering, and installation expertise increases project complexity and cost. The long-term maintenance requirements of green roofs, including regular watering, vegetation management, and occasional repairs, can pose challenges for building owners. In regions with harsh climatic conditions, such as extreme temperatures or heavy snowfall, maintaining healthy vegetation on green roofs can prove difficult and expensive. Furthermore, the weight of green roof systems needs careful consideration during the design phase, as it may impose limitations on building structural integrity. The lack of standardization and inconsistent building codes across different regions further complicates the adoption process and hinders market growth. Finally, concerns about the potential for leaks and structural damage if not properly installed and maintained can dissuade potential adopters.

The layered green roof system type holds a larger market share, but modular systems are experiencing accelerated growth due to their ease of installation and adaptability to various roof types and sizes. However, the growth of modular green roofs is expected to be faster due to several factors:
Ease of Installation: Modular systems are much simpler to install than layered systems, reducing labor costs and project timelines.
Cost-Effectiveness: Often, the prefabricated nature of modular systems translates to lower installation costs and improved project management.
